Plants release water to the atmosphere through a process called transpiration. Water is taken up by the roots and transported to the leaves, where it evaporates through tiny openings called stomata. This helps regulate the plant's temperature and maintain its internal water balance.
Plants take in air through tiny pores on their leaves called stomata. They absorb carbon dioxide (CO2) from the air during photosynthesis and release oxygen (O2) as a byproduct. Plants also release water vapor through a process called transpiration.
C4 plants keep their stomata closed during hot and dry conditions to reduce water loss through transpiration. By keeping their stomata closed during these times, C4 plants can minimize water loss while still being able to carry out photosynthesis efficiently using their unique carbon fixation pathway.
